The ecommerce landscape is rapidly changing. Global spending on eCommerce in 2012 reached just over 1 trillion dollars. 82% of those who shop online still do so through the traditional method of a desktop pc or laptop. However, over the past couple of years, mobile shopping has seen increases year on year with 18% now shopping either through their mobile phone or portable tablet device. This figure was as low as 2% back in 2010.
